We used to make these ornaments out of old Christmas Cards when I learned how to make these growing up - I've had fun making these with the awesome CTMH papers lately. Here are some of both kinds and different sizes. I use my Coluzzle circle to cut out the pieces for the 3-D Circle Ornaments, which is SO much easier than we used to do it - we used to trace and then cut out each circle. I also mixed in some different shapes in here - circles with a square inside, squares on squares, etc, they're really fun to play with! The bigger balls have 20 circles, the smaller balls have 8 circles, the square ones are made up of 6 pieces.





I made these ones for friends who had babies within the last couple months - the other side has a spot for baby's picture.

These are the ones the girls made. I cut and scored their circles, they picked their paper and cut and pasted their triangles and then put them together. These are proudly hanging on our tree.
